Scientists Find Adding Natural Hormone Boosts Brain Function In Hypothyroidism

Researchers have discovered that combining standard treatment with a second natural hormone, triiodothyronine, improves cognitive symptoms in hypothyroidism patients. The study found that brain function, memory, and energy levels increased significantly with the combined therapy.

Autoimmunity Gene Discovered

Researchers have identified a novel human gene responsible for the systemic autoimmune disease APECED. The discovery provides valuable insights into the mechanisms of destructive autoimmune responses and may hold significance for other autoimmune conditions like diabetes and rheumatoid arthritis.

Thyroid Hormones May Influence Neural Function, Study Suggests

Scientists examining rat brains with underactive thyroid glands found differences in neuronal responses to serotonin, a neurotransmitter important for circulatory control. The study suggests thyroid hormones have an impact on mature brains, potentially affecting depression treatment.

Routine Screenings For Mild Thyroid Disorder Recommended

Thyroid screening can prevent mild problem from becoming severe and reverse undiagnosed symptoms, according to a Johns Hopkins study. Screening costs are comparable to other preventative tests, with greatest savings from lowering cholesterol and heart disease risk.
